UFC 146 Main Card Breakdown

UFC 146 Main Card Breakdown

| May 24, 2012 | 5:00 pm | Reply

Coming up this Saturday, May 26, UFC 146: Dos Santos vs. Mir comes to you live from the MGM Grand Garden Arena in Las Vegas, Nevada. When this card was first announced, people were going crazy over the original main event between Junior Dos Santos and Alistair Overeem. Unfortunately, Overeem was pulled from the card after a failed drug test and the MMA world was up in arms trying to figure out who would take his place. Two weeks later, Dana White announced via Twitter that former UFC Heavyweight Champion, Frank Mir, would be filling in against Junior Dos Santos.

UFC 145: Jones vs. Evans Medical Suspensions

UFC 145: Jones vs. Evans Medical Suspensions

| April 23, 2012 | 8:52 pm | Reply

Following this weekend’s UFC 145: Jones vs. Evans event, the Georgia Athletic and Entertainment Commission passed out suspensions to 20 of the 24 fighters. Three fighters were issued lengthy suspensions, while one was given an indefinite suspension.

UFC 145 Undercard Results

UFC 145 Undercard Results

| April 21, 2012 | 6:58 pm | Reply

Welcome to the UFC Chad Griggs! Griggs made his UFC debut tonight and it took Travis Browne two huge knees and an Arm Triangle to end it just 2:30 seconds into the opening frame. Travis Browne threw a picture perfect flying knee and followed it up with another knee that rocked Griggs. Moments later he took Griggs down and mounted him. Griggs showed some inexperience at that point almost pushing Browne into position for the Arm Triangle and then tapping moments later.
